What is Skrooge (Windows port)?

Skrooge (Windows port) is a classic and open-source finance software designed to help users manage their personal finances effectively. It is a free, multi-lingual, and highly customizable application that allows users to track their income and expenses, create budgets, and set financial goals. Skrooge (Windows port) is a Windows port of the popular Skrooge software, which was originally designed for Linux and macOS.

Main Features

Skrooge (Windows port) offers a wide range of features that make it an ideal choice for personal finance management. Some of its main features include:

  • Multi-account management: Skrooge (Windows port) allows users to manage multiple accounts, including bank accounts, credit cards, and investments.
  • Transaction tracking: The software enables users to track their transactions, including income and expenses, and categorize them for easy analysis.
  • Budgeting: Skrooge (Windows port) allows users to create budgets and set financial goals, making it easier to manage their finances effectively.
  • Investment tracking: The software enables users to track their investments, including stocks, bonds, and mutual funds.
  • Reporting: Skrooge (Windows port) provides detailed reports on income, expenses, and investments, making it easier to analyze financial data.
